The fox is taking over the henhouse
As the Texas Education Agency continues to move forward with its hostile takeover of HISD we are getting glimpses of what lies ahead. Last week the TEA formally launched its recruitment and application process for the Board of Managers with two community meetings that were unmitigated disasters. The Houston Chronicle editorial board asked the question on all of our minds, If TEA can’t run a meeting, how can they run HISD?

Taking the public out of public education
Last night’s TEA community meeting is a warning of what we can expect from the Texas Education Agency’s anti-democratic hostile takeover.
TEA said they would only answer written questions about the board of managers process and when parents complained, the TEA cherry-picked the questions to answer. The Kashmere meeting is last and most of the meetings are far away from the schools that are most at risk of closure.

"Broad" Schools: What TEA Is Planning Is Nothing New
Mike Miles, likely HISD superintendent pick, graduated from the Broad Academy. This is what it’s like to teach at a school that won the Broad Prize.
It is tempting to sit back and wait to see what happens when TEA takes over. They will wrap it up in a pretty package and make it look like they are helping our kids learn. But any model that prioritizes test scores and accountability above human beings will end up exactly how my school did. The only way to impose joyless learning is through rigid control, intimidation, and force. [En español aqui]
